WDFW seeks public input on daft policy for non-native game fish management

Fellow Anglers Concerned about our Non-Native Game Fish (NNGF), Please see the attached WDFW News Release for the opportunity to provide your comments on the NNGF Policy.  Please send this to everyone you know that might help.  Non-native game fish such as smallmouth and largemouth bass, perch, crappie and walleye are under attack again!  The WDFW (Washington Department of Fish and Wildlife) has posted the current version of the Non-Native Game Fish Policy on their website at…See More

2014 ABA Tournament Schedule

April 5 & 6 Lake Washington
May 10 & 11 Lake Sammamish
June 21 & 22 Tri-Cities
July 19 & 20 Potholes
August 9 & 10 Banks Lake
August 23 & 24 Lake Washington

September 5 & 6 Championship Tri-Cities


Membership fees:
$30 per year for single.
$35 per year for family.
I can sign you up at the tournament if you want.

Tourney fees:
Basic entry $195 per tournament then option pots if you want.
